Mozambique - Neonatal Mortality Rate
Since 2014, Mozambique Neonatal Mortality Rate decreased by 1.9% year on year. With 28.5 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Live Births in 2019, the country was ranked number 20 comparing other countries in Neonatal Mortality Rate. Mozambique is overtaken by Equatorial Guinea, which was ranked number 19 at 29 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Live Births and is followed by Dominica with 28.1 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Live Births. Lesotho lead the ranking with 42.8 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Live Births in 2019, a fall of 1.4% compared to 2018. Pakistan, Central African Republic and South Sudan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Venezuela witnessed the best average annual growth at +5.3% per year, while Macedonia was the worst growing country at -15.6% per year.
